Output 3d33e922a76a014f490ced9904fda6ede63ee39e2126ce89cc636f02762449f2:32

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004f03105e5336f0889a235a4342de551f887178 OP_EQUAL
address
31ieaPfVafQdv6wc6G8NtS791U4S8mtwuR
transaction
3d33e922a76a014f490ced9904fda6ede63ee39e2126ce89cc636f02762449f2
confirmations
232622
spent
true